
Chartist Js
Chartist.js emerges from a community's quest for a more customizable charting experience, addressing the shortcomings of existing libraries. Its unique CSS styling capabilities allow for cleaner designs and seamless animations. With an intuitive override mechanism for media queries, developers can effortlessly tailor chart behavior, making it an ideal choice for dynamic dashboards and UIs.

Chartist Js Review and Overview
The charts are designed with flexibility in mind by optimizing the separation of concerns in such a way that you can control the charts with javascript and modify the styling with CSS. SVG is used to create the charts, which is currently the premier technology in web illustration.
Create professional charts
DPI independent charts are scalable for any screen size. You can also modify their configuration using media queries. Most new modern browsers, including internet explorer, chrome, safari and iOS, can support and correctly display charts made in ChartistJS.
Animate your charts
Charts can be quickly animated to provide an interactive element to your website. This animation is made possible by the separation of design and logic when working with charts. CSS based animations, as well as transitions, can be applied to the SVG elements to give animation effects and deliver more information. Almost all project libraries, including Angular, React, and Wordpress is able to act as wrapper libraries for Chartist. It also provides an animation API known as SMIL that can help in modifying the properties of charts on the fly while the data updates in the background.
Configuration at your fingertips
You can modify chart style easily using CSS; however, sometimes the behaviour of the charts need to be controlled according to various actors. Changes in data and threshold may cause you to redraw multiple elements of your graphs. To achieve this, ChartistJS provides a configuration overwrite mechanism which uses media queries to induce changes in real-time. The override mechanism prioritizes based on the specification of the matching media queries. You can change the visibility factor of different elements such as dots and lines as well as specify label interpolations to fit the various screen sizes.
